SINGAPORE - Organisers of the Formula One Singapore Grand Prix are open to altering the circuit in light of the impending redevelopment of the Marina Bay floating platform.

In response to queries from The Straits Times, race promoters Singapore GP and the Singapore Tourism Board said in separate statements they would work together with other stakeholders to review the layout of the Marina Bay Street Circuit and make necessary adjustments should any changes be required.
